This model works well if you have a stable team that needs constant training access. You assign individual licenses to a set number of people for guaranteed access anytime. It’s perfect for ensuring continuity in mandatory, long-term programs like compliance or internal sales certification requirements.

If your user base changes frequently or only requires access occasionally, this model is a great fit. Instead of paying for fixed licenses, this grants learners on-demand access based on actual monthly usage. This scalable approach ensures you only pay when people are actively learning, which is efficient for fluctuating external audiences like partners or customers. đź’ˇ
